Chebyshev polynomials of the first kind are a sequence of orthogonal polynomials defined on the interval [-1, 1] that are particularly useful in approximation theory, numerical analysis, and various fields of applied mathematics. They are denoted as $$T_n(x)$$, where $$n$$ is a non-negative integer, and they exhibit properties like minimizing the maximum error of polynomial interpolation, making them essential in contexts like polynomial approximation and function approximation.
